本文目录导读:
在信息技术的飞速发展过程中,数据的物理结构作为数据存储与处理的基础,其重要性不言而喻,数据的物理结构主要涉及数据的表示和存储过程,本文将深入探讨这两种方式及其在现实中的应用。
图片来源于网络,如有侵权联系删除
数据的物理结构表示
1、非结构化数据表示
非结构化数据是指无法用传统关系型数据库进行存储和管理的数据,如文本、图像、音频和视频等,其表示方式主要包括以下几种:
(1)文本表示:通过字符串、字符集等对文本数据进行编码,实现数据的存储和检索。
(2)图像表示:利用像素矩阵对图像进行编码,实现图像的存储、传输和处理。
(3)音频表示:通过音频信号采样、量化等手段,将音频信号转换为数字信号,实现音频数据的存储和播放。
(4)视频表示:采用帧序列和编码技术,将视频信号转换为数字信号,实现视频数据的存储、传输和播放。
2、结构化数据表示
结构化数据是指可以用表格形式进行存储和管理的数据,如关系型数据库中的数据,其表示方式主要包括以下几种:
(1)关系模型:通过表格形式组织数据,其中行代表实体,列代表属性,关系模型具有较好的数据完整性、一致性和易于扩展等特点。
(2)层次模型:以树状结构表示数据,适用于表示具有层次关系的数据,如组织机构、家族关系等。
图片来源于网络,如有侵权联系删除
(3)网状模型:以网状结构表示数据,适用于表示具有复杂关系的数据,如社会关系、网络拓扑等。
数据的物理结构存储过程
1、数据库存储
数据库是数据存储的核心技术,主要包括以下存储过程:
(1)数据插入:将新数据添加到数据库中。
(2)数据查询:根据条件从数据库中检索数据。
(3)数据更新:修改数据库中的数据。
(4)数据删除:从数据库中删除数据。
2、文件存储
文件存储是指将数据以文件形式存储在磁盘、光盘等存储设备上,其存储过程主要包括:
(1)数据写入:将数据写入文件。
图片来源于网络,如有侵权联系删除
(2)数据读取:从文件中读取数据。
(3)文件组织:对文件进行分类、命名和索引,以便于管理和检索。
3、分布式存储
分布式存储是指将数据分散存储在多个节点上,以提高数据可用性、可靠性和性能,其存储过程主要包括:
(1)数据分割:将数据分割成多个小块,分别存储在多个节点上。
(2)数据复制:在多个节点上复制数据,以提高数据可用性。
(3)数据同步:保证不同节点上的数据一致性。
数据的物理结构包括数据的表示和存储过程,对于数据的存储、传输和处理具有重要意义,本文对非结构化数据、结构化数据及其表示方式进行了探讨,并分析了数据库、文件和分布式存储等存储过程,在实际应用中,应根据具体需求选择合适的物理结构,以提高数据处理的效率和质量。
标签: #数据的物理结构包括什么的表示和存储过程
评论列表